Key Features to Look For
1. Capacity
Dishwasher capacity is measured in place settings. A standard dishwasher holds about 12-14 place settings. If you have a large family or entertain often, look for a model with higher capacity. Smaller households might be fine with a 10-12 place setting model.
2. Wash Cycles and Options
Most dishwashers offer several wash cycles like Normal, Heavy Duty, and Light. Look for special cycles that fit your needs. Some common ones include:
- Quick Wash: For lightly soiled dishes.
- Sanitize Cycle: Kills bacteria with hot water.
- Delicate Cycle: For fragile items like glassware.
- Half Load: Saves water and energy when you don’t have a full load.
3. Energy Efficiency
Look for the ENERGY STAR label. ENERGY STAR certified dishwashers use less energy and water, saving you money on utility bills. They also help the environment.
4. Noise Level
Dishwashers can be noisy. The noise level is measured in decibels (dB). A quieter dishwasher will have a lower dB rating. Many modern dishwashers operate at around 45-50 dB, which is quite quiet.
5. Interior Features
Check out the racks and silverware baskets. Adjustable racks allow you to fit larger items. Some dishwashers have a third rack for cutlery and small utensils. Good interior lighting can also be a nice bonus.
Important Materials
The exterior finish is what makes it a “slate” dishwasher. This is usually a coated metal that mimics the look of natural slate. The interior tub is typically made of stainless steel. Stainless steel is durable, resists stains and odors, and helps with drying.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: What is a slate dishwasher?
A: A slate dishwasher is a dishwasher with a special finish that looks like natural slate. This finish gives your kitchen a modern and elegant appearance.
Q: Is the slate finish durable?
A: Yes, the slate finish on dishwashers is designed to be durable and resistant to fingerprints and smudges, making it easy to clean.
Q: How does a slate dishwasher compare to stainless steel?
A: Slate offers a unique, softer look than stainless steel. Both are durable, but slate is often preferred for its fingerprint resistance and distinct style.
Q: Are slate dishwashers more expensive?
A: Prices can vary, but slate dishwashers are often in a similar price range to stainless steel models. The cost depends more on the brand and features than the finish itself.
Q: What are the best wash cycles to use?
A: The best cycle depends on how dirty your dishes are. Use “Normal” for everyday loads, “Heavy Duty” for tough, baked-on food, and “Quick Wash” for lightly soiled items.
Q: How do I clean my slate dishwasher?
A: You can usually clean the exterior with a soft, damp cloth. Avoid abrasive cleaners that could scratch the finish.
Q: Can I put pots and pans in a slate dishwasher?
A: Yes, most dishwashers can handle pots and pans, especially those with a “Heavy Duty” cycle. Check your dishwasher’s manual for specific recommendations.
Q: What does ENERGY STAR certified mean?
A: ENERGY STAR certified dishwashers are tested to use less energy and water than standard models, saving you money and helping the environment.
Q: How quiet is a typical slate dishwasher?
A: Many modern slate dishwashers are very quiet, often operating at around 45-50 decibels (dB). This is similar to normal conversation.
Q: Can I fit large items like baking sheets in my dishwasher?
A: Many dishwashers have adjustable racks. You can often move or fold down parts of the racks to make space for larger items like baking sheets or platters.
